Title: The Innovative Mind of Erik Holmgren
Introduction
Erik Holmgren, an accomplished inventor based in Lidingo, Sweden, has made significant contributions to the field of biotechnology. With six patents to his name, Holmgren has focused on the development of matrix metalloproteinases, which play a crucial role in various biological processes.
Latest Patents
Holmgren's latest patents revolve around matrix metalloproteinases (MMPs). His inventions provide genes encoding novel matrix metalloproteinases, constructs and recombinant host cells that incorporate the genes, as well as the MMP polypeptides encoded by these genes. Additionally, his patents include antibodies to the MMP polypeptides and methods for making and utilizing all of the aforementioned components. These innovations highlight his commitment to advancing our understanding of MMPs and their applications in medicine.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Erik Holmgren has been associated with notable companies such as Pharmacia & Upjohn Aktiebolag and Esperion Therapeutics, Inc. His work at these organizations has contributed to his expertise in the field and has facilitated the development of his groundbreaking patents.
Collaborations
Holmgren has collaborated with esteemed colleagues, including Mats Lake and Cesare Sirtori. These collaborations have enriched his research and innovation efforts, allowing for a mutual exchange of ideas and expertise in the realm of biotechnology.
